Use the word heredocs in Here Documents docs
Two advantages: - higher relevance of the extremely common word "heredocs" which may help people find this page when searching for "ruby heredocs" - the anchor link becomes `#label-Here+Documents+-28heredocs-29`, which is ugly due to the parentheses but includes the word "heredocs" in the URL to this section If anyone knows a way to prevent RDoc from turning invalid characters into ugly and meaningless ASCII codes, I'm listening. I don't want to break existing anchor links but RDoc should really ignore these characters or turn them into dashes. Closes: https://github.com/ruby/ruby/pull/2103
